That's an Emmons GS-10, student model. It appears to have been refinished with a paint brush and some aluminum angle along the edges, and a different fretboard. I own one of these guitars, I think 599 would be a good price, even with the cosmetic issues. However, it looks like a non standard set up. There are raises on 1,2,3,5 and 6, and no lowers. So it's anyone's guess as to how it actually set up. You would need to convert it to a standard E9th tuning. You would probably need a few parts too. But it still not an outrageous price, in my opinion. Not too bad a deal if someone is looking for a project. |
